当用户在测试服务器上发送返回401的请求时,我已经删除了端点,.it在本地运行良好
401 -未经授权:访问因凭据无效而被拒绝。您没有使用所提供的凭据查看此目录或页的权限。
我试图给予文件夹所有权限,但没有使用
发布于 2018-04-04 12:10:07
我们就是这样修好的
<modules>
<remove name="WebDAVModule"/>
</modules>
<handlers>
<remove name="WebDAV" />
<remove name="ExtensionlessUrl-Integrated-4.0" />
<add name="ExtensionlessUrl-Integrated-4.0"
path="*"
verb="*"
type="System.Web.Handlers.TransferRequestHandler"
preCondition="integratedMode,runtimeVersionv4.0" />
</handlers>
<security>
<requestFiltering>
<verbs>
<add verb="DELETE" allowed="true" />
<add verb="PUT" allowed="true" />
</verbs>
</requestFiltering>
</security>
发布于 2018-03-30 19:36:44
我认为您应该通过移除DELETE
在IIS上启用WebDAV
动词。
在您的web.config
上添加这一行
<modules>
<remove name="WebDAVModule" />
</modules>
<handlers>
<remove name="WebDAV" />
</handlers>
https://stackoverflow.com/questions/49563543
复制相似问题